View PostCurccu, on 31 October 2014 - 12:06 AM, said:

Those Mgs, 10 must HS rule and 2,5 tons of ammo leaves you .64 tons for those two energy weapons.
So epic hero ability Lolcust with "no 10 HS must rule"-feat could do 12 MG with 3 tons of ammo... I would buy it ;)


You don't need to drop the 10 Heat-Sink rule to make it work.

I'd load it with two small lasers, six MGs, and two tons of ammo. You equip Endo and Ferro, but stay with Standard Heatsinks. It's not going to run hot, anyway, so it's whatever about the loss of heat dissipation.

Alternatively, you can fit two medium lasers if you drop a half ton of ammo and bump down to an XL180 engine. This one will run a bit hot, but the extra utility might be worth it.

But yeah, I so want a 6x MG Locust. I sincerely hope they don't make it a 2x Missile, 2x Ballistic Locust. That would be silly hard to optimize and ultimately not that different from the LCT-1M.
